当前位置:首页 » 编程语言 » sql实现变化率计算
扩展阅读
webinf下怎么引入js 2023-08-31 21:54:13
堡垒机怎么打开web 2023-08-31 21:54:11

sql实现变化率计算

发布时间: 2023-06-10 18:18:49

㈠ 请高手指教:如何利用一个sql语句查询出一个表中价格上涨(或下降)的记录,最好还能计算出变化率

首先你的表要设计的合理呀,对一个物品每次价格的修改都要有记录,这样要查询上涨下降和变化率不是很简单吗。

㈡ SQL如何计算趋势增长

根据数据库文件每个月的增长量,计算出数据库的增长率。

请按照此思路操作。

㈢ sql 怎么把数据库里的计算公式 进行计算

工具/材料:Management Studio。

1、首先在桌面上,点击“Management Studio”图标。

㈣ sql server 2005 如何计算表中的增长率

表中的什么东西的增长率
建议提问时把问题描述清楚否则别人无法回答

㈤ sql 怎么把数据库里的计算公式 进行计算

方法和详细的操作步骤如下:

1、第一步,在桌面上,双击“
Management Studio”图标,见下图,转到下面的步骤。

㈥ 使用sql语句计算百分比

  • 1、若针对每行求百分比: select SA/TotelTime ,SB/TotelTime ,SC/TotelTime ,SD/TotelTime ,SE/TotelTime from 表名 。

  • 2、若是对总计后的值求百分比: select sum(SA)/sum(TotelTime) ,sum(SB)/sum(TotelTime) ,sum(SC)/sum(TotelTime) ,sum(SD)/sum(TotelTime) ,sum(SE)/sum(TotelTime) from 表名

  • 3、当然,以上都是以小数形式显示结果,若要以百分比形式显示结果:乘以100,并保留两位小数,然后加上“%”即可。
    如:round((SA/TotelTime)*100,2) & "%"

㈦ 用SQL怎么计算完成率

计算完成率需要知道任务的总数以及已经完成的数量。假设有一个任务表Task,包含任务ID、任务名称、任务状态等字段,可以使用SQL语句计算完成率,如下所示:

上SQL语句分别计算了任务总数、已完成任务数和完成率。其中,第一个SELECT语句计算了任务总数;第二个SELECT语句计算了已完成任务数,通过WHERE条件过滤状态为“completed”的弊埋任务;第三个SELECT语句使用了子查询来获取任务总数,并计算完成率。瞎卜举最后的结果会返回任务的完成率,例磨碧如:75%。

㈧ SQL如何计算增长率

select a.date,a.num/b.num-1 as 增长率
from 表 a join 表b
on a.date=CONVERT(char(7),dateadd(mm,1,b.date+'-01'),121)

㈨ 如何编写一个SQL存储过程来计算百分比,计算的方法就想Excel中的percentile一样! 请会的大虾们帮帮忙,谢

用方法吧,用存储过程做什么?
CREATE OR REPLACE FUNCTION f_get_percent(fz NUMBER, fm NUMBER) RETURN VARCHAR2 IS
v_result VARCHAR2(4000);
BEGIN
IF nvl(fm, 0) <> 0 THEN
v_result := round(nvl(fz, 0) / fm, 4) * 100 || '%';
END IF;
RETURN(v_result);
END f_get_percent;

用法:SELECT f_get_percent(1, 3) FROM al;
结果:33.33%